Career Role (Urban Cultural Engagement) Description
Urban Regeneration Project Manager Leads and manages projects focused on revitalizing urban spaces, incorporating cultural initiatives. Strong project management and stakeholder engagement skills are essential.
Cultural Policy Officer Develops and implements policies to promote and support cultural activities within urban environments. Requires policy analysis, strategic planning, and communication expertise.
Community Arts Officer Works directly with communities to develop and deliver arts and cultural programs. Excellent communication, community engagement, and project management skills are required.
Heritage Consultant Advises on the preservation and promotion of cultural heritage in urban contexts. Expertise in heritage management, conservation, and community engagement is crucial.
Creative Industries Manager Manages and develops creative businesses and projects within urban areas. Requires business acumen, marketing skills, and understanding of the creative sector.
